Justesen","doi":"10.1109/VTC.1978.1622585","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622585","url":null,"abstract":"In the wake of dwindling supplies of fossil fuels and of mounting opposition to nuclear energy, the Solar Power Satellite (SPS) is emerging as a seriously considered source of energy. Launched by rockets of terrestrial or of lunar origin, the satellite would be inserted into geosynchronous orbit, would extend giant vanes to capture sunlight that would be converted to microwaves, and would beam the microwaves to the earth's surface where they would be trapped and transformed to direct current by a massive rectifying antenna. The potential costs of the SPS system, which may result in 100 to 200 orbiting satellites early in the 21st Century, are being reticulously weighed by officials and scientists of the Department of Energy and of the National Aeronautics and Space Administration. The benefits of a virtually continuous supply of \"clean\" energy must be assayed against the costs of raw materials and acquisition of land, the effects of rocket-fuel effluvium on the atmosphere, the influence of the microwave beam on the ionosphere, and the potential perturbation of ecological systems by microwave fields above and at the periphery of rectifying antennae. The scope of the risk-benefit analyses transcends national boundaries; indeed, agreements on an international scale would be necessary--and could be expanded to make the SPS system a multinational venture. However, long before the launching of the first satellite, a concensus would have to be reached as to the safety and practicability of the system. Of primary concern in this, the first phase of assessing impact, re biological and ecological effects of continuouswave microwave energy at power densities that would approximate 25 mW/cm2 near the center of the rectifying antenna and would fall to microwatt levels at the perimeter of the so-called ar a of exclusion. Currently unknown, but under investigation, are the effects of continuous, long-term microwave irradiation on airborne species that may traffic across the rectifying antenna and on other species that may inhabit the environs of the exclusion area. The extant data on biological effects of microwaves are too limited to provide \"hard\" predictions on the effects of continuous radiation over decades of time, but do indicate several areas in need of clarification. Of especial concern is whether airborne birds, bats, and beneficial insects such as the bees will be able to sustain flight through microwave fields of relatively high density--or whether they will learn to avoid these fields. Cooper","doi":"10.1109/VTC.1978.1622517","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622517","url":null,"abstract":"Considerable theoretical work has been done on the applications of spread spectrum techniques to high capacity cellular mobile radio systems. [1], [2], [3], [4]. This theoretical work assumes a receiver structure that is mathematically convenient and does not address the problem of implementing such a receiver. The study reported on here examines a number of possible configurations and modifications of the mathematical model with respect to the feasibility of their physical implementation with advanced and state-of-the-art components. The critical component in a spread spectrum receiver employing time-frequency coded signals is a tapped delay line with a maximum delay that is twice the duration of the signal waveform. For current signal designs the maximum delay is about 600 microseconds. Both surface acoustic wave (SAW) devices and charge coupled devices (CCD) are considered as possible realizations of this component. The current design limitations of both SAW devices and CCD's, as applied to the proposed application, are discussed. In addition, the extent to which the limitations of future devices will have to be improved in order to meet the requirements of a fully developed spread spectrum system is presented.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"36 10","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"132880653","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Gruver","doi":"10.1109/VTC.1978.1622599","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622599","url":null,"abstract":"Field testing of an Automatic Vehicle Monitoring (AVM) system employing overlapping RF signposts is described. Tests were directed toward assessing the feasibility of using the AVM system for locating both random-route and fixed-route vehicles. Emphasis is placed on describing the acquisition and analysis of location error data. The conditions under which tests were conducted in order to guarantee the integrity and objectivity of the tests are described. The results obtained prove conclusively that the overlapping signpost approach and variants thereof can meet the AVM requirements of transit, para-transit, police, etc., fleets.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"11 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"124313908","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Hynes","doi":"10.1109/VTC.1978.1622562","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622562","url":null,"abstract":"The longitudinal control system for a vehicle follower automated transit vehicle has the dual requirements of controlling the vehicle speed and also the spacing between vehicles. Previous attempts at designing these loops individually has resulted in a control system where the two loops are in conflict. Proposed techniques for resolving this problem have required that the loops be switched in and out depending on the control mode. A simplified control system structure with both spacing and velocity loops operating simultaneously is proposed as a solution to the vehicle follower control problem. The operating gains for these loops are based on using a subset of the gains derived by linear optimal control theory corresponding to the actual loops present. The final controller design uses gain scheduling on the spacing loop integral gain term. This system is shown to operate effectively in the presence of both large and small spacing errors.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"95 36","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"120971485","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Skomal","doi":"10.1109/VTC.1978.1622507","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622507","url":null,"abstract":"Technical assessments of six commercially available AVL systems have been performed. Among the system features included in the study were the positioning accuracy, the communication links, the central computer requirements for possible fleet sizes, and environmental factors such as road conditions which influence performance. For all AVL techniques, a position estimation accuracy has been performed based upon the individual features of each method. The AVL methods examined contain various error sources which have been combined in the analyses in models appropriate to each system. The instantaneous position estimation error thereby derived has been used to form a time-expanded vehicle position error which includes the effect of discontinuous sampling of vehicle data either by a vehicle-mounted position monitor or a central control station. Positioning accuracy data exist for most of the six AVL technologies. These data have been used for comparison with the analytical error models. Results of the experimental and theoretical comparisons are presented and discussed.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"22 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"127166872","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Martin","doi":"10.1109/VTC.1978.1622544","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622544","url":null,"abstract":"Leaky feeder techniques are being used increasingly to provide radio communication with men and vehicles in mines and tunnels. A continuing study by the UK National Coal Board has devoted considerable attention to the use of line-powered repeaters in such systems to compensate for line losses as they occur. Several different ways of achieving duplex communication with simple one-way repeaters have been developed or proposed, and these are capable of providing a far more even and reliable performance than was possible with the earlier multiple-base-station operation. The engineered systems described have been developed primarily for coal mines, where considerations of intrinsic safety impose severe restrictions on line-fed power. The resulting need for highest efficiency in the repeaters overrides considerations of linearity, and the threat of intermodulation interference arises in multichannel operation. This in turn may be countered by further system techniques such as time-division-multiplexing and diversity.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"18 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"125320803","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Kotzin, A. van den Heuvel","doi":"10.1109/VTC.1978.1622583","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622583","url":null,"abstract":"Due to the relatively low noise environment which currently prevails in the 800 MHz spectrum recently allocated for land mobile radio systems, it is of considerable interest to determine the extent to which this situation is likely to deteriorate as the usage of the band grows. To this end, an extensive series of measurements of both noise level and received signal levels around 450 MHz has been conducted at a typical base station repeater site in the Chicago area, and the resulting data used to estimate the future noise environment at 800 MHz when this band reaches a similar level of maturity. In order to gather the data, a specialized scanning receiver system was constructed which sequentially samples the signal level on every channel over a 4 MHz band around 456 MHz while simultaneously monitoring the noise level on two unused channels near the middle of the band. During data collection each of the channels is sampled at a 6 Hz rate for a period of approximately 30 minutes during the midday peak of activity. This data, in conjunction with analytical models to convert it to equivalent 800 MHz data, has been used to estimate the probable noise level at 800 MHz in the future.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"50 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"130635475","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Hudak","doi":"10.1109/VTC.1978.1622552","DOIUrl":"https://doi.org/10.1109/VTC.1978.1622552","url":null,"abstract":"The Federal Communications Commission's (FCC), Field Operations Bureau (FOB) has released the results of a study on interference with television reception associated with Citizens Band Radio. The report is based on investigation of a random selection of interference complaints received by six FCC field offices -- Baltimore, Buffalo, Kansas City, Norfolk, San Francisco and Seattle -- over a one year period. These complaints were analyzed through technical measurements on the complainant's TV receiver and the CB equipment, as well as through interviews with other residents in the CB operator's neighborhood. The report is unique in that it represents \"real-life\" television interference situations rather than predictions based on laboratory data. The findings of the study are discussed in this paper in the hope that the empirical data will provide new insight as to the causes of the CB-TV interference problem and will lead to preventative actions by involved parties.","PeriodicalId":264799,"journal":{"name":"28th IEEE Vehicular Technology Conference","volume":"78 10 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1978-03-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"128091677","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
